Output d87ac28ed3f2d264a34f659c499f36268bc153c5d7abbd54977aaf1371fb63ba:1

value
252786
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d15c2f0862f195f785c19e33f7211a2cd9f3bbcb OP_EQUAL
address
3Ln1ag2C3HGePkTtNkTVnWAafTiu46cdXX
transaction
d87ac28ed3f2d264a34f659c499f36268bc153c5d7abbd54977aaf1371fb63ba
confirmations
334111
spent
true